From Wikipedia:

Cortex Command is a 2-dimensional side-scrolling action game developed by Data Realms. In the game, the player takes the role of a disembodied brain, who controls various clones to achieve his aims. The main goal of the game is mining gold, which is used to purchase new clones, weaponry and craft which is then used to eliminate competitors. As the brain is weak, the player must manage his resources carefully, protecting the brain, mining gold and fighting off enemies. The game includes the ability for players to create mods (additions and changes to the game) with the built in Lua programming applet, and simple scripting.

I had some new TA stuff which I wanted to post, so I logged in and browsed around. It was strange to see a Cortex Command thread here. Some of you may be familiar with the older TA related things I've done, but I've actually also done some work on Cortex Command (Gfx, design and some tool programming).

Cortex Command is still a work in progress. We haven't really gotten much of the content done (there are still a lot of placeholders) and it's overall highly unpolished and haphazard. We are lucky to have an active community which has produced quite a bit of content, some of it amazing things we would never had thought of. It's a bit of a sandbox game/engine at the moment, so there's no polished single player experience or anything like that, yet.

We receive (and read) a lot of feedback and ideas, more than we can process and respond to. To be honest though, a lot of the feedback we're getting concerns things which we have already been made aware of or were a part of the original grand plan. On one hand it's frustrating to only be able to work on one thing at a time while people tell us to work on everything. On the other hand it's nice to know that a lot of people generally agree with us... there's a kind of convergence there.
